WebA generalized arithmetic progression ( GAP) ( multiple arithmetic progression, - dimensional arithmetic progression) is defined as. where the are fixed. The number , that is the number of permissible differences, is called the dimension of the generalized progression; arithmetic progressions (AP) being of dimension 1. In mathematics, generalized means (or power mean or Hölder mean from Otto Hölder) are a family of functions for aggregating sets of numbers.
